Is It Time to Move to a PEO?

A Professional Employer Organization (PEO) is a company that partners with businesses to handle payroll, benefits, and HR tasks under one roof. Think of it as an extension of your team—taking care of the behind-the-scenes work like payroll tax filings, employee benefits, and compliance so you can stay focused on running your business. So, is it time for you to consider moving to a PEO?

Take this short quiz and find out:

Answer yes or no to each:

  1. We’ve outgrown DIY payroll and HR tools.
    Managing benefits, compliance, and payroll is taking more time than it should.
  2. We’re struggling to keep up with HR and tax compliance.
    Multi-state employees, new labor laws, or ACA filings are starting to feel overwhelming.
  3. Our benefits aren’t keeping up with employee expectations.
    We’d like to offer stronger health coverage, retirement plans, or wellness perks without breaking the budget.
  4. We need more support, but not more headcount.
    We want access to HR expertise, multi-state payroll processing, and compliance guidance without hiring a full in-house team.
  5. We’re planning for growth in 2026.
    As we scale, we need systems that can scale with us – without slowing us down.

Your Results:

  • Mostly Yes: A PEO could simplify operations, reduce compliance risk, and improve benefits – freeing you to focus on growth.
  • Mostly No: You may still be well-suited to an in-house model. Revisit this quiz each year as your team and needs evolve.
